Original language description
The primary focus of this article is a case study of a child diagnosed with an orofacial cleft defect. The primary objective of this study is to analyse the effectiveness of the speech and language therapy intervention implemented over a period of 14 months. In the initial entry, the basic and essential anamnestic data of the examined child are summarised. A significant domain pertains to the initial and concluding diagnosis of communication capability. The central section is dedicated to a comprehensive exposition of the direct speech and language therapy intervention, including diagnostic tools used, assessments and assistive devices.
